September 29, 2004
This Race Is As Wide-Open as the LLM & Kerry Need It To BeSo Kerry not only has to catch up (to the degree these volatile polls show him behind) "Volatile"? The big polls have consistently shown Bush ahead by 6-13 points. Even tossing out the 13, 12, and 11 point post-convention leads, there doesn't seem a lot of "volatility" in that persistent 6-8 point advantage. The polls aren't just consistent with themselves; they're cross-consistent with each other. But it's very "volatile." Gee, one day Bush is up by 13, the next day he has a paltry 8-point lead. posted by Ace at 11:21 AM
